Downsville, MD vs Myersville, MD
There is a significant gap in the cost of living between these two cities. Downsville is 21% cheaper than Myersville. With a cost index of 102 vs 129, the difference would have a meaningful impact on a household's monthly budget. Someone relocating from Downsville to Myersville should plan for substantially higher expenses across most categories.
When it comes to buying, median home values in Downsville are $344,600 compared to $457,900 in Myersville, a 25% gap.
Median household income in Downsville is $212,605 compared to $144,840 in Myersville (+46.8%). Downsville offers a double advantage: higher earnings combined with a lower cost of living, giving residents significantly more purchasing power.
